Matt LeBlanc had dislocated his shoulder on set attempting a sight gag. As a result, his arm was in a protective sling. At the beginning of this episode, Chandler overhears Joey bouncing on his bed and falling off. This was written into the story to explain why the character would be wearing a sling.
After Matt LeBlanc injured his shoulder taping the previous episode (The One Where No One's Ready (1996)), he was rushed backstage to receive medical attention and was surprised to see Anthony Edwards of ER (1994) - which was filmed at a nearby soundstage - dressed in character as Dr. Mark Greene. Though LeBlanc knew Edwards wasn't a real doctor, he was concerned about whether or not he also suffered a head injury as well.
Series producer Marta Kauffman has stated she regrets the stalker storyline and that "We did a lot of rewriting on that to make that work."
David Arquette, who plays Malcolm, the man following Phoebe, starred in the Scream franchise with, and later married, Courteney Cox, who plays Monica. Cox and Arquette later divorced after nearly 14 years of marriage.
